For the uninitiated, Ghosts Season 1, Episode 7 ( "Flower's Article" ) is a fan-favorite turning point. The plot follows Sam (Rose McWhorter) as she tries to write a feature about the Woodstone B&B’s "haunted" history, inadvertently exposing the free-spirited, hippie ghost Flower’s criminal past as a bank-robbing radical. ghosts s01e07 240p
